Discrete Distributions

S1 • E4
There's more than one way to be truly random! Delve deeper into probability by surveying several discrete probability distributions—those defined by discrete variables. Examples include Bernoulli, binomial, geometric, negative binomial, and Poisson distributions—each tailored to answer a specific question. Get your feet wet by analyzing several sets of data using these tools.
